[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[commits] r14201 - in /fsf/glibc-2_13-branch/libc: ./ sysdeps/i386/i686/multiarch/ sysdeps/x86_64/multiarch/



Author: eglibc
Date: Wed Jun 15 00:05:28 2011
New Revision: 14201

Log:
Import glibc-2.13 for 2011-06-15

Modified:
    fsf/glibc-2_13-branch/libc/ChangeLog
    fsf/glibc-2_13-branch/libc/NEWS
    fsf/glibc-2_13-branch/libc/sysdeps/i386/i686/multiarch/memcpy-ssse3-rep.S
    fsf/glibc-2_13-branch/libc/sysdeps/i386/i686/multiarch/memcpy-ssse3.S
    fsf/glibc-2_13-branch/libc/sysdeps/x86_64/multiarch/memcpy-ssse3-back.S
    fsf/glibc-2_13-branch/libc/sysdeps/x86_64/multiarch/memcpy-ssse3.S

Modified: fsf/glibc-2_13-branch/libc/ChangeLog
==============================================================================
--- fsf/glibc-2_13-branch/libc/ChangeLog (original)
+++ fsf/glibc-2_13-branch/libc/ChangeLog Wed Jun 15 00:05:28 2011
@@ -1,3 +1,12 @@
+2011-02-06  Mike Frysinger  <vapier@xxxxxxxxxx>
+
+	[BZ #12653]
+	* sysdeps/i386/i686/multiarch/memcpy-ssse3-rep.S: Only protect
+	MEMCPY_CHK with USE_AS_BCOPY ifdef check.
+	* sysdeps/i386/i686/multiarch/memcpy-ssse3.S: Likewise.
+	* sysdeps/x86_64/multiarch/memcpy-ssse3.S: Likewise.
+	* sysdeps/x86_64/multiarch/memcpy-ssse3-back.S: Likewise.
+
 2010-09-28  Andreas Schwab  <schwab@xxxxxxxxxx>
 	    Ulrich Drepper  <drepper@xxxxxxxxx>
 

Modified: fsf/glibc-2_13-branch/libc/NEWS
==============================================================================
--- fsf/glibc-2_13-branch/libc/NEWS (original)
+++ fsf/glibc-2_13-branch/libc/NEWS Wed Jun 15 00:05:28 2011
@@ -13,7 +13,7 @@
   11655, 11701, 11840, 11856, 11883, 11903, 11904, 11968, 11979, 12005,
   12037, 12067, 12077, 12078, 12092, 12093, 12107, 12108, 12113, 12140,
   12159, 12167, 12191, 12194, 12201, 12204, 12205, 12207, 12348, 12378,
-  12394, 12397, 12489
+  12394, 12397, 12489, 12653
 
 * New Linux interfaces: prlimit, prlimit64, fanotify_init, fanotify_mark
 

Modified: fsf/glibc-2_13-branch/libc/sysdeps/i386/i686/multiarch/memcpy-ssse3-rep.S
==============================================================================
--- fsf/glibc-2_13-branch/libc/sysdeps/i386/i686/multiarch/memcpy-ssse3-rep.S (original)
+++ fsf/glibc-2_13-branch/libc/sysdeps/i386/i686/multiarch/memcpy-ssse3-rep.S Wed Jun 15 00:05:28 2011
@@ -110,7 +110,7 @@
 #endif
 
 	.section .text.ssse3,"ax",@progbits
-#if defined SHARED && !defined NOT_IN_libc && !defined USE_AS_BCOPY
+#if !defined USE_AS_BCOPY
 ENTRY (MEMCPY_CHK)
 	movl	12(%esp), %eax
 	cmpl	%eax, 16(%esp)

Modified: fsf/glibc-2_13-branch/libc/sysdeps/i386/i686/multiarch/memcpy-ssse3.S
==============================================================================
--- fsf/glibc-2_13-branch/libc/sysdeps/i386/i686/multiarch/memcpy-ssse3.S (original)
+++ fsf/glibc-2_13-branch/libc/sysdeps/i386/i686/multiarch/memcpy-ssse3.S Wed Jun 15 00:05:28 2011
@@ -110,7 +110,7 @@
 #endif
 
 	.section .text.ssse3,"ax",@progbits
-#if defined SHARED && !defined NOT_IN_libc && !defined USE_AS_BCOPY
+#if !defined USE_AS_BCOPY
 ENTRY (MEMCPY_CHK)
 	movl	12(%esp), %eax
 	cmpl	%eax, 16(%esp)

Modified: fsf/glibc-2_13-branch/libc/sysdeps/x86_64/multiarch/memcpy-ssse3-back.S
==============================================================================
--- fsf/glibc-2_13-branch/libc/sysdeps/x86_64/multiarch/memcpy-ssse3-back.S (original)
+++ fsf/glibc-2_13-branch/libc/sysdeps/x86_64/multiarch/memcpy-ssse3-back.S Wed Jun 15 00:05:28 2011
@@ -49,7 +49,7 @@
   ud2
 
 	.section .text.ssse3,"ax",@progbits
-#if defined SHARED && !defined NOT_IN_libc
+#if !defined USE_AS_BCOPY
 ENTRY (MEMCPY_CHK)
 	cmpq	%rdx, %rcx
 	jb	HIDDEN_JUMPTARGET (__chk_fail)

Modified: fsf/glibc-2_13-branch/libc/sysdeps/x86_64/multiarch/memcpy-ssse3.S
==============================================================================
--- fsf/glibc-2_13-branch/libc/sysdeps/x86_64/multiarch/memcpy-ssse3.S (original)
+++ fsf/glibc-2_13-branch/libc/sysdeps/x86_64/multiarch/memcpy-ssse3.S Wed Jun 15 00:05:28 2011
@@ -49,7 +49,7 @@
   ud2
 
 	.section .text.ssse3,"ax",@progbits
-#if defined SHARED && !defined NOT_IN_libc
+#if !defined USE_AS_BCOPY
 ENTRY (MEMCPY_CHK)
 	cmpq	%rdx, %rcx
 	jb	HIDDEN_JUMPTARGET (__chk_fail)